SUMMER TAX DEFERMENTS

The City of Marshall Treasurer’s Office is currently accepting applications for Summer tax deferments.  Payment of the Summer taxes normally due by September 15 can be deferred until February 14 without penalty.  Note: this is not an exemption or reduction in the tax amount.  A deferment is valid for one year.  A deferment application must be submitted to the City Treasurer’s Office each year by September 15 to be eligible to defer that year's summer taxes.

To qualify, a household income cannot exceed $40,000.00. The applicant must also be 62 years of age or older, paraplegic, quadriplegic, hemiplegic, eligible serviceperson, veteran, widow of widower, blind or totally and permanently disabled. For more information, please contact the Treasurer’s Office at (269) 781-5183.  All deferment applications must be received by September 15 each year.
